This course empowers families and communities with crucial skills they need during crises. HOST: That's inspiring. Could you tell us about any current trends in family emergency preparedness? GUEST: Sure, there's growing emphasis on whole community approaches, which engage various sectors of the community in emergency planning. Additionally, technology is playing a bigger role in early warning systems and disaster communication. HOST: Interesting. What challenges have you faced or observed in teaching this subject? GUEST: The main challenge is overcoming misconceptions that disasters only happen to others. People often underestimate the value of being prepared until it's too late. HOST: That's a common issue. Looking forward, where do you see the future of family emergency preparedness heading? GUEST: I believe we'll continue seeing more integration of technology, greater focus on mental health preparedness, and increased collaboration between public and private sectors.
